Cozumel: Disney Cruise Line’s Dolphin Discovery Excursion

Cozumel, Mexico, was one of the ports of call during our 5-night Western Caribbean Very Merrytime Cruise on the Disney Magic in December 2017. I was very excited that we would be traveling to Mexico on this cruise. I had visited Cozumel previously when I was a teenager, cruising with my family on-board a Holland America ship (this was way before Disney Cruise Line even existed!). During that visit, we tendered to Playa del Carmen and did a fantastic excursion to the Tulum Mayan ruins and Xel-Ha, a beautiful brackish water lagoon where we snorkeled. At the end of the excursion, we boarded the ship in Cozumel, where it had docked after dropping us off (and this was at night: it was quite a long day).
